Explain the Adrenal Medulla
The adrenal medulla secretes epinephrine or adrenaline and norepinephrine or noradrenaline. The secretory cells of the medulla are modified postganglionic sympathetic neurons. Epinephrine and norepinephrine secreted from the adrenal medulla have similar stimulatory or inhibitory effects as the epinephrine and norepinephrine released from sympathetic nerves.
